【Excel中LEN函数和LENB函数使用教程】在Excel中,`LEN` 和 `LENB` 是两个用于计算文本长度的常用函数,但它们在处理不同字符时表现有所不同。以下是对这两个函数的总结与对比,帮助用户更好地理解和使用。
一、函数简介
函数名 | 功能说明 | 适用场景 |
LEN | 计算文本字符串中字符的数量(按字节计算) | 英文、数字、单字节字符的长度统计 |
LENB | 计算文本字符串中字节数(按实际存储字节计算) | 中文、日文、韩文等多字节字符的长度统计 |
二、函数语法
- LEN(text)
- 参数:`text` 是要计算长度的文本字符串。
- 返回值:返回字符串中字符的数量(每个字符为1个单位)。
- LENB(text)
- 参数:`text` 是要计算字节数的文本字符串。
- 返回值:返回字符串中所占的字节数(每个中文字符占2个字节,英文字符占1个字节)。
三、使用示例
示例内容 | LEN结果 | LENB结果 | 说明 |
"Hello" | 5 | 5 | 英文字符,每个占1字节 |
"你好" | 2 | 4 | 中文字符,每个占2字节 |
"12345" | 5 | 5 | 数字字符,每个占1字节 |
"A1中" | 4 | 6 | 混合字符,英文和数字各1字节,中文2字节 |
"Excel" | 5 | 5 | 英文字符,无特殊编码 |
四、使用注意事项
1. 字符类型影响结果
- 对于英文和数字,`LEN` 和 `LENB` 的结果相同。
- 对于中文、日文、韩文等多字节字符,`LENB` 的结果会比 `LEN` 大。
2. 空单元格或空字符串
- 如果单元格为空,`LEN` 和 `LENB` 都会返回 `0`。
3. 特殊符号或空格
- 空格和其他符号也会被计入长度,需注意数据清洗。
4. 结合其他函数使用
- 可以将 `LEN` 或 `LENB` 与其他函数如 `LEFT`、`RIGHT`、`MID` 结合使用,实现更复杂的文本处理。
五、应用场景
- 数据校验:检查输入字段是否符合长度限制(如密码、手机号等)。
- 文本截断:根据字符数或字节数进行文本截断。
- 信息统计:统计文章、评论等内容的长度,用于分析或展示。
六、总结对比表
特性 | LEN | LENB |
计算单位 | 字符数 | 字节数 |
英文/数字 | 1字节/字符 | 1字节/字符 |
中文/多字节字符 | 1字符 | 2字节 |
适用范围 | 单字节字符 | 多字节字符 |
是否区分语言 | 不区分 | 区分 |
通过合理使用 `LEN` 和 `LENB`,可以更准确地处理不同语言环境下的文本数据,提升Excel在数据处理中的灵活性和准确性。